Abstract:
At the present, terahertz technology is certainly one of the most dynamic research fields with wide variety of applications: terabit wireless communication, spectroscopy, biology, medical sciences, food control, security systems, etc. The project aims to investigate advanced conventional as well as structured materials in Terahertz and millimeter wave range. On one hand, highly accurate characterization methods of complex perovskite dielectrics (bulk and thin films) with high values of the product between the quality factor and the frequency will be developed for millimeter wave and Terahertz range. The application of development methods to measure ferroelectric perovskites in Terahertz range is very important for such applications as tunable photonic crystal filters. On the other hand, numerical and experimental investigations on structured materials will allow the study of the Terahertz spoof surface plasmon-polaritons in new complex geometries. The electromagnetic simulation, fabrication and characterization of the proposed materials and structures will benefit of recent acquisitioned state-of-the-art equipment in the host institution. The final outcome of the project will consist in solution for an improved controlled of the electromagnetic radiation in millimeter wave and Terahertz range.

Abstract:
The primary aim is to obtain novel nanostructured semiconductor materials based on Ge nanoparticles (nps) with optimized properties to be used in photodetectors for the visible and infrared (VIS-NIR) ranges, and also in nonvolatile (NV) memory devices. This aim will be realized in the following objectives: A) Preparation and characterization of nanostructured films based on Ge nps in SiO2, TiO2, HfO2, with optimized photoconductive and electrical properties; B) Preparation and complex characterization of experimental models for VIS-NIR photodetector and NV memory using the optimized materials; C) Fabrication of VIS-NIR photodetector and NV memory to prove experimentally the concepts of the project and its applications; D) Estimation of the economic impact.
Based on the material research (Phase 1), and on the investigations of structures and experimental models (Phase 2), two prototypes will be fabricated in Phase 3, one for the VIS-NIR photodetector, and one for the NV memory, with corresponding technical specifications. Thus, we will prove that the novel nanostructured materials based on Ge nps obtained in this project are suitable for VIS-NIR photodetectors and NV memory devices. Also, the technical and economical analyses documentation and feasibility studies will be performed (Phase 4).
The two devices will be integrated into a system for event identification and an automated test and measurement system for industrial applications and manufacturing devices will be realized.

Abstract:
Few studies in the literature focused on the (photo)electrical properties of nanocrystalline germanium (nc-Ge) based materials, in contrast with the structural and optical ones. The aim is to prepare and to study nanostructured films consisting of nc-Ge immersed in amorphous matrix with good photoconductive properties. To achieve this goal we propose the following objectives: 1 Preparation of films with different concentrations of nc-Ge embedded in amorphous matrices; 2 Study of electrical properties in correlation with the morphology of layers. Experiment and modelling; 3 Study of photoconductive properties in correlation with morphology of layers. Experiment and modelling; 4 Dissemination of research results. The intended original results are: optimal preparation conditions will be determined to obtain films with improved photoconductive properties; dominant electrical transport mechanism will be proposed and percolation parameters will be calculated; transitions between energy levels evidenced in electrical and photransport phenomena will be identified and corresponding quantum confinement energy levels will be found; films with improved photoconductive properties will be obtained.
